if (!$user->isLoggedIn()) { Redirect::to('login.php'); } include "include/global_header.php"; include "include/menu.php"; date_default_timezone_set('Europe/Amsterdam'); ?> </head> <body> <div class="content"> <?php if (Input::exists()) { if (Token::check(Input::get('token'))) { $opdrachtgever = new Opdrachtgever(); try { $opdrachtgever->create_markt(array('opdrachtgever' => Input::get('opdrachtgever'), 'tel' => Input::get('tel'), 'email' => Input::get('email'), 'plaats' => Input::get('plaats'), 'straat' => Input::get('straat'), 'postcode' => Input::get('postcode'), 'website' => Input::get('website'))); $opdrachtgever->create_opdrachtgever(array('bedrijf' => Input::get('opdrachtgever'), 'voornaam' => Input::get('voornaam'), 'achternaam' => Input::get('achternaam'), 'tel' => Input::get('tel'), 'email' => Input::get('email'))); $volledigenaam = Input::get('voornaam') . " " . Input::get('tussenvoegsel') . " " . Input::get('achternaam'); $opdrachtgever->create_contactpersoon(array('opdrachtgever' => Input::get('opdrachtgever'), 'voornaam' => Input::get('voornaam'), 'tussenvoegsel' => Input::get('tussenvoegsel'), 'achternaam' => Input::get('achternaam'), 'volledigenaam' => $volledigenaam, 'tel' => Input::get('tel2'), 'email' => Input::get('mail'))); } catch (Exception $e) { die($e->getMessage()); } } } ?> <div class="list editprofile shadow"> <div class="title radius"><img src="img/iSkill.png" height="30" /><p>Opdrachtgever toevoegen</p></div> <div class="content"> <form id="frm" name="frm" method="post" action="">
<script type="text/javascript"> function menu(){ $('.navmarkt').addClass('selectedmenu'); } </script> </head> <body onLoad="menu()"> <div class="content"> <?php if (Input::exists()) { if (Token::check(Input::get('token'))) { $validate = new Validate(); $validation = $validate->check($_POST, array('opdrrachtgever' => array(), 'tel' => array(), 'plaats' => array(), 'straat' => array(), 'postcode' => array(), 'website' => array())); if ($validation->passed()) { $opdrachtgever = new Opdrachtgever(); // oude code insert in de markt insert (id , opdrachtgever, tel, plaats, straat, postcode, website) try { $opdrachtgever->create(array('opdrachtgever' => Input::get('opdrachtgever'), 'tel' => Input::get('tel'), 'email' => Input::get('email'), 'plaats' => Input::get('plaats'), 'straat' => Input::get('straat'), 'postcode' => Input::get('postcode'), 'website' => Input::get('website'))); } catch (Exception $e) { die($e->getMessage()); } } else { // ouput errors //print_r($validation->errors()); foreach ($validation->errors() as $error) { echo $error, '<br>'; } } } }
<script type="text/javascript"> function menu(){ $('.navmarkt').addClass('selectedmenu'); } </script> </head> <body onLoad="menu()"> <div class="content"> <?php if (Input::exists()) { if (Token::check(Input::get('token'))) { $validate = new Validate(); $validation = $validate->check($_POST, array('naam' => array('required' => true, 'min' => 2, 'max' => 20), 'tel' => array(), 'mail' => array())); if ($validation->passed()) { $opdrachtgever = new Opdrachtgever(); // oude code insert in de markt insert (id , opdrachtgever, tel, plaats, straat, postcode, website) try { $opdrachtgever->create(array('voornaam' => Input::get('naam'), 'tel' => Input::get('tel'), 'mail' => Input::get('mail'))); } catch (Exception $e) { die($e->getMessage()); } } else { // ouput errors //print_r($validation->errors()); foreach ($validation->errors() as $error) { echo $error, '<br>'; } } } }